Bug#690765: lastfmsubmitd: please delete log files on purge



Package: lastfmsubmitd
Version: 1.0.6-3
Severity: normal

-----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E-----
Hash: SHA1

Policy 10.8 says:
Log files should be removed when the package is purged (but not when it is only
removed). This should be done by the postrm script when it is called with the
argument purge (see Details of removal and/or configuration purging, Section 6.8).

Please do that.
